Report Overview

Process burners, flares, and thermal oxidizer systems are critical components in industrial operations, particularly in oil & gas, petrochemicals, and waste management sectors, designed for safe and efficient combustion of gases, vapors, and hazardous emissions. Process burners ensure controlled combustion in furnaces and boilers, flares handle emergency gas disposal, and thermal oxidizers destroy volatile organic compounds (VOCs) and hazardous air pollutants (HAPs) to meet environmental regulations. The market for these systems is driven by stringent emission standards, increasing industrial production, and the growing emphasis on waste-to-energy solutions. Key players focus on energy efficiency, low-NOx technologies, and modular designs to cater to diverse applications, while regions with heavy industrial activity, such as North America, Europe, and Asia-Pacific, dominate demand. Rising investments in refinery expansions, chemical manufacturing, and environmental compliance further fuel market growth, though high installation costs and the shift toward electrification pose challenges.

The global Process Burners Process Flares Thermal Oxidizer Systems market size was estimated at USD 1325.85 million in 2024 and is projected to grow at a compound annual growth rate (CAGR) of 2.83% during the forecast period.
